Teams at odds over sporting penalties for budget cap breaches
Mercedes F1 boss Toto Wolff says three F1 teams have taken a stance against applying sporting penalties for budget cap violations. For the first time in the sport's history, teams are restricted this season to a $145 million budget. While there are financial provisions included in the rules to sanction teams that breach the cost cap limit, the plan is also to include minor sporting penalties and more significant ones. But the teams have yet to agree on the definitive list of sanctions, with Red Bull, AlphaTauri and Ferrari reportedly opposing sporting penalties. Wolff said the situation would likely be cleared up in the coming weeks. Read also: Teams' financial compensations for Sprint...
